Visual Artist Dorothy Thibodeau, an Acadian from the "French Shore",
is best known for her portraits of animals, houses and boats and her
still life seashell paintings. Her paintings in watercolour,
acrylic and pastels can be seen at her gallery situated at 384
Patrice Road in Church Point, Nova Scotia, at the Yarmouth
Waterfront Gallery on Water Street, Yarmouth from May to October,
and at the Grou Tyme Acadian Festival, Halifax, N.S. |
